Breakdown of Granite gray (#676767)

#676767 is made up of (103, 103, 103) in RGB colorspace and (0.00, 0.00, 0.00, 59.61) in CMYK colorspace. Its decimal value is 6776679 and the closest web-safe color code to it is #666666. White should be used ontop of #676767 to ensure the best legibility.

Triadic Colors of Granite gray (#676767)

The Triadic color scheme is made up of three colors. When viewed on a color wheel, all three colors are spaced evenly (120°) apart.

This color scheme tends to produce colors that are quite vibrant, regardless of saturation.

Tetradic Colors of Granite gray (#676767)

Fours colors make up the Tetradic color scheme. All four colors are spaced evenly (90°) apart when visualized on a color wheel.

Find balance between the warm and cold colors if you desire to use the Tetradic color scheme in your design.

Analagous Colors of Granite gray (#676767)

The Analagous color scheme is made up of three colors. The three colors sit next to one another on the color wheel. The palette is made in similar fashion to how the Split Complimentary palette is made. However, the two secondary colors are adjacent to the base, not the compliment.

Analagous colors often appear in nature. If you're designing with the outdoors in mind, keep this color harmony at your disposal.
